what joints are visualized in oblique L spine
lumbar Zygopopheseal joints
eye of the scotty dog
pedicle
nose of the scotty dog
transverse process
neck of the scotty dog
pars interarticularis
front leg of the scotty dog
inferior articular process
ear of the scotty dog
superior articular process
tail of the scotty dog
superior articular process of the opposite side
body of the scotty dog
lamina and spinous process
back leg of the scotty dog
inferior articular process of the opposite side
which parts of the scotty dog form the Z joint
ear of inferior vertebrae, front leg of superior vertebrae
degree of obliquity for oblique L spine
45 degrees
if overrotated, pedicle is ____ of body
posterior
if underrotated, pedicle is ____ of body
anterior
CR for lumbar oblique L spine
2 in medial to elevated ASIS, 1-1.5 inches above crest
collimation for oblique L spine
9 x 12
degree of obliquity to show L5 S1 Z joints
60 degrees
CR to show L5 S1 z joints
midway between ASIS and crest, 2 in medial
breathing and arms instructions for oblique L spine
suspend respiration, arms like praying
collimation for flexion and extension L spine
14 x 17
CR for flexion / extension L spine
midcoronal plane @ level of spinal fusion (L3)
breathing for flexion extension L spine
suspend respiration
what pathology is shown for flexion extension L spine
motion in area of spinal fusion indicating non union, or herniated disk
